在 Lubuntu 上安装和运行 couchdb 失败

在 Lubuntu 上安装和运行 couchdb 失败

我试图在最近安装了 Lubuntu (15.10) 的笔记本电脑上开始使用 CouchDB。我遇到了奇怪的问题。

昨天,我安装了 CouchDB(sudo apt-get install couchdb)并且运行良好。

今天,当我重新打开电脑时,我注意到我无法从 CouchDB 加载任何 Futon 页面 - 它没有运行。

我的问题与这里描述的问题大致相同: Ubuntu 15.10 上 CouchDB 1.6 的安装问题 但是,为了解决这个问题,我还尝试使用 apt-get 重新安装 CouchDB。(发出 remove 命令,删除 /etc/couchdb,执行 apt-get install)。此安装现在失败,并显示

chmod: cannot access ‘/etc/couchdb/local.ini’: No such file or directory
dpkg: error processing package couchdb (--configure):
 underprosessen installerte post-installation-skript returnerte feilstatus 1
Det oppstod feil ved behandlinga av:
 couchdb
E: Sub-process /usr/bin/dpkg returned an error code (1)

每次我安装东西时都会出现这个错误。我该如何修复这些问题(或者至少找出问题所在)?

答案1

通过创建所需的 local.ini 文件,该特定安装错误确实消失了。我不明白它一开始是如何进入这种状态的,但是

sudo touch /etc/couchdb/local.ini
sudo chown couchdb:couchdb /etc/couchdb/local.ini
sudo apt-get install couchdb

成功了,安装过程完成了。

相关内容